Output 756022b9750712093f87fbc2f698a160c4317b64821ce6b12709def86f305b25:25

value
849806447
script pubkey
OP_0 OP_PUSHBYTES_20 d794a32c69b44ae0b817eb714c8c6a24dfccaa91
address
bc1q6722xtrfk39wpwqhadc5err2yn0ue253sglmda
transaction
756022b9750712093f87fbc2f698a160c4317b64821ce6b12709def86f305b25
spent
true